The new Akcent hotel is situated on the 7th floor of a 1930s' office building in Functionalist style right at the Anděl metro station and boasts splendid views over Prague from all rooms. It is situated in a quiet part of the Smichov district, from where several tram lines bring you right into the centre of the Golden City. The picturesque Lesser Town is just a 15-minute walk away. Enjoy spacious and nicely furnished rooms with balconies, air-conditioning, a satellite TV, tea and coffee making facilities, a fully stocked mini-bar and free Wi-Fi access. Daily lunch menus and an à la carte menu are served at the restaurant. Relax on comfortable sofas in the beautiful hotel lobby with a satellite TV and a multilingual library with various books, newspapers and magazines. Fancy a bit of gambling or just a drink? Pop into Card Casino just next to the hotel lobby! Friendly and English speaking staff will be at your disposal 24 hours a day. A supervised outdoor car park is available at an additional cost. The Anděl City and Zlatý Anděl shopping centres are very close by. Moreover, the Nový Smíchov shopping and entertainment centre with its 2 multiplex cinemas and several restaurants is just 3 minutes' walk from the hotel.
